Solution. … WitrynaAbout py_vollib ¶. py_vollib is a python library for calculating option prices, implied volatility and greeks. At its core is Peter Jäckel’s source code for LetsBeRational, an extremely fast and accurate algorithm for obtaining Black’s implied volatility from option prices.. Building on this solid foundation, py_vollib provides functions to calculate …

Witryna29 kwi 2024 · data ['Log returns'].std () The above gives the daily standard deviation. The volatility is defined as the annualized standard deviation. Using the above formula we can calculate it as follows. volatility = data ['Log returns'].std ()*252**.5. Notice that square root is the same as **.5, which is the power of 1/2.
